## Support

Rounding errors in the Coppervale conversion module stem from intermediate float math; the fix in v2.4 moves all conversions to fixed-point. Known residual: sub-cent drift on chained conversions across three or more currencies. File issues with a reproducible amount and currency pair. For urgent discrepancies, reach the payments support desk.

alerts address for kajog-tadup: druox@plorvanet.internal

Ticket: Missed pick-up — notarised deed. The courier from Marlow Dispatch did not arrive for yesterday's scheduled collection of the notarised deed for the Ferngate Row property transfer. The deed remains sealed in the front-office cabinet, logged under the Harwick file. A replacement pick-up has been booked for tomorrow morning between nine and eleven. Please ensure someone is at the front desk for the whole window, as the driver cannot wait. The hand-over instruction for the courier is as follows.

handover note for tafog-bawef: the ulair kasael courier leaves the ralok gilmir fenael druwyn feneth queniel belix keliel ledger at gate 5216 under passcode 961436

Handing off the Ledgerline migration to you for tonight's window. We use expand-contract: the new columns on `invoices` are already live and dual-written, so step three only flips reads. Do not drop the old columns until the verifier job reports zero drift for a full hour. If the migration runner loses its vault session mid-flight, unlock it with the recovery passphrase noted immediately below this paragraph.

strongbox words: zorwyn-sorael-belion-ulaius-silmir-ulays-briax-rusdor-gorix